Light rain or drizzle likely in northern region of Bangladesh in 5 days: BMD

Light rain or drizzle likely in northern region of Bangladesh in 5 days: BMD

News Desk :: Light rains or drizzle is likely over the northern parts of the country in the next five days from 9 am on Saturday. According to a regular bulletin of Bangladesh Meteorological Department (BMD) “A mild cold wave is sweeping over Panchagarh and it may continue.”

Weather may remain dry with temporary partly cloudy sky over the country.

Moderate to dense fog may occur over the country during midnight to morning and it may continue at places till noon. Besides, air navigation, inland river transport and road communication may disrupt temporarily due to dense fog.

Night temperature may rise slightly and day temperature may rise by (1-2)°C over the country. Meanwhile, night and day temperatures may fall till Thursday. Ridge of sub-continental high extends up to West Bengal and adjoining area.

Seasonal low lies over South Bay, extending it’s trough to Northeast Bay.
